Paylines, Ways to Win, and Cluster Pays Explained
Modern spinning games, such as those found in online slot machines and casual mobile apps, rely on a Random Number Generator (RNG) to determine outcomes. This core mechanic ensures every spin is independent and statistically unpredictable, producing a sequence of numbers that maps to reel positions or symbols. The RNG algorithm runs continuously, even when the game is idle, to prevent pattern prediction. Game developers pair this with a paytable that defines winning combinations and payout values. Online slot mechanics also incorporate a “Return to Player” (RTP) percentage, which mathematically guarantees the house edge over millions of spins. Volatility, another key design element, controls the frequency and size of payouts.
- RNG: Generates random, fair results for each spin.
- RTP: Theoretical long-term payout percentage to the player.
- Volatility: Risk level affecting win frequency and payout size.
Q: Is a slot spin truly random?
A: Yes, modern certified RNGs produce statistically random results, so no spin influences the next.
Volatility and Hit Frequency: Choosing Your Risk Level
Modern spinning games, particularly those found in online casinos and mobile apps, rely on random number generators (RNGs) as their core mechanic to ensure unpredictable outcomes for each spin. The primary game mechanics in slot games are built around determining win conditions through symbol matching across paylines or via a “ways-to-win” system. These systems are managed by complex algorithms that calculate return-to-player (RTP) percentages and volatility, balancing risk and reward. Key loops include:
- **Spin cycle:** Player initiates the spin, RNG selects a number, which maps to a specific symbol combination on the reels.
- **Payout evaluation:** The game checks the resulting arrangement against a predefined paytable and applies multipliers for winning lines.
- **Feature triggers:** Landing specific scatter or bonus symbols activates secondary mechanics like free spins, cascading reels, or progressive jackpots.
This structured cycle creates the core interaction loop that sustains player engagement.

Live Dealer Slots and Interactive Hosts
Modern spinning games are dominated by digital integration and mechanic complexity. The core innovation is the widespread adoption of random number generation (RNG) technology, ensuring each spin’s outcome is statistically independent and unpredictable. This digital RNG system forms the backbone of fair play in these games. Developers now layer these with cascading reels, where winning symbols disappear and new ones drop in, creating chain reactions. Key features often include:
- **Megaways mechanics**, which alter the number of symbols per reel on each spin.
- **Cluster pays**, rewarding groups of adjacent matching symbols rather than fixed paylines.
- **Buy-in bonuses**, allowing players to directly purchase access to high-volatility bonus rounds.
These additions increase engagement without altering the fundamental spin action, focusing player attention on achievable, varied outcomes.
